For the 2025 school year, there are 3 public middle schools serving 1,670 students in Farmerville, LA.
The top ranked public middle schools in Farmerville, LA are D'arbonne Woods Charter School, Union Parish High School and Union Parish Alternative Center.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Farmerville, LA public middle schools have an average math proficiency score of 44% (versus the Louisiana public middle school average of 31%), and reading proficiency score of 42% (versus the 42% statewide average). Middle schools in Farmerville have an average ranking of 7/10, which is in the top 50% of Louisiana public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 43%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the Louisiana public middle school average of 60% (majority Black).
